Born This Way

Uganda has dominated the news recently for anti-homosexuality laws.
Cameroon currently apparently has more arrests for homosexuality than anywhere else in the world.
This documentary follows four gay individuals living in modern day Cameroon.


Big Men

Oil in Africa is another hot topic mired in secrecy, corruption and exploitation.

Able to get 'unprecedented access' of America oil giants in Nigeria and Ghana, this promises remarkable footage and a gripping account of what really goes on behind the scenes.
